FSCTL_MANAGE_BYPASS_IO IOCTL (ntifs.h)
Die FSCTL_MANAGE_BYPASS_IO Steuerelementcode steuert BypassIO-Vorgänge für eine bestimmte Datei in den Filter- und Dateisystemstapeln.
Hauptcode
FSCTL_MANAGE_BYPASS_IO
Eingabepuffer
Zeigen Sie auf eine FS_BPIO_INPUT Struktur, die Informationen zur BypassIO-Anforderung enthält.
Eingabepufferlänge
Größe der FS_BPIO_INPUT Struktur, auf die InputBuffer in Byte verweist.
Ausgabepuffer
Zeiger auf eine FS_BPIO_OUTPUT Struktur, in der Informationen zum BypassIO-Vorgang zurückgegeben werden sollen.
Länge des Ausgabepuffers
Größe der FS_BPIO_OUTPUT Struktur, auf die OutputBuffer in Byte verweist.
Eingabe-/Ausgabepuffer
n/a
Länge des Eingabe-/Ausgabepuffers
n/a
Statusblock
Reserviert für die Systemverwendung.
Bemerkungen
Rufen Sie zum Ausführen dieses Vorgangs FltFsControlFile- oder ZwFsControlFile- mit den folgenden Parametern auf.
Parameter | Beschreibung |
---|---|
Instanz- | [in] Nur für FltFsControlFile. Ein undurchsichtiger Instanzzeiger für den Aufrufer. Dieser Parameter ist erforderlich und darf nicht NULL sein. |
FileObject- | [in] Nur für FltFsControlFile. Ein Dateiobjektzeiger für die Datei oder das Verzeichnis, das das Ziel dieser BypassIO-Vorgangsanforderung ist. Dieser Parameter ist erforderlich und darf nicht NULL sein. |
FileHandle- | [in] Nur für ZwFsControlFile. Dateihandle der Datei, für die der BypassIO-Vorgang angefordert wird. Dieser Parameter ist erforderlich und darf nicht NULL sein. |
FsControlCode- | [in] Auf FSCTL_MANAGE_BYPASS_IOfestgelegt. |
InputBuffer- | [in] Zeigen Sie auf eine FS_BPIO_INPUT Struktur, die Informationen zur BypassIO-Anforderung enthält. |
InputBufferLength- | [in] Größe des Puffers, auf den InputBuffer in Bytes |
OutputBuffer- | [out] Zeiger auf eine FS_BPIO_OUTPUT Struktur, in der Informationen zum BypassIO-Vorgang zurückgegeben werden sollen. |
OutputBufferLength- | [out] Größe des Puffers, der OutputBuffer in Byte zeigt. |
Weitere Informationen finden Sie unter BypassIO für Filtertreiber.
Anforderungen
Anforderung | Wert |
---|---|
mindestens unterstützte Client- | Windows 11 |
Header- | ntifs.h |